#1. Which is the only country in the world to have a native population of both Tigers and Lions?
Both Asiatic Lions and Royal Bengal Tigers are native to India.
#2. India, just being 2% of the earth's total landmass, is home to what percentage of biodiversity is present?
8% of total biodiversity has its home in India.
#3. A special breed of a camel named Kharai that can swim in water can be found in which state of India?
Kharai breed of camels can swim and survive on saline plants and mangroves.
#4. Largest Zoo in India is located in which of these cities?
India’s largest zoo is located in Alipore, Kolkata.
#5. How many bird species are only found in India?
Sixty-nine species of birds are endemic to India. In total, India is home to 12% of the world’s bird species.
#6. Gangetic Dolphins that live in Ganga are
Gangetic Dolphins that are born and live in Ganga are blind by birth.

#8. How many species of reptiles are only found in India?
One hundred fifty-six reptile species are endemic to India.
#9. How many plant species are found in India?
A total of fifty thousand species of plants are found in India.
#10. Spectacled Cobra is another name of which snake?
Indian Cobra is also know as Spectacled Cobra.
